How to do search with multiple keywords
 
I had a saved search set up that I ran everyday to look for multiple motorhome brands filtered to my specs. About 3-4 weeks ago the search stopped working with the error to "generalize my search criteria". I think now it will only return ads that meet all the search keywords.

There are only 6 or so key words used. I tried a comma, dash and colon between the keywords to no avail. I used to use a space between the key words before. Did the criteria change in one of the updates or is there a new way to separate key words?

I don't want my search to only find ads with all my key words, rather I want to find ads that have one or more of my keywords.

Hi Mikes5115, Becky from RacingJunk here. Try going to our advanced search http://www.racingjunk.com/search and type in your search as you want it (you can choose "any of these words" in the dropdown). When the results show up, try saving the it. It will give you the option to save the search at the top of the search results. Let me know if that works. Thanks!
